Output 24d5c50fb2697ed2324eb09ec5bc8a75e9684449e1bdba0747631442ffa68ee8:2

value
40721990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5b671faf0419f9acaecbafc527fe81ea1b4853 OP_EQUAL
address
MKRGsP2ZfNkg8NCg61UzS9BduXfpMjBWbK
transaction
24d5c50fb2697ed2324eb09ec5bc8a75e9684449e1bdba0747631442ffa68ee8
spent
true